FR301 - FR307 3.0A FAST RECOVERY RECTIFIER Features * * * * * Low Reverse Recovery Time (Trr) Low Reverse Current Low Forward Voltage Drop High Current Capability Plastic Material - UL Recognition 94V-0 A B A D C Mechanical Data * * * * * Case: DO-201AD, Molded Plastic Terminals: Axial Leads, Solderable per MIL-STD-202 Method 208 Polarity: Color Band Denotes Cathode Approx. Weight: 1.1 grams Mounting Position: Any Dim A B C D DO-201AD Min 25.4 7.2 1.2 4.8 Max -- 9.5 1.3 5.3 All Dimensions in mm Maximum Ratings and Electrical Characteristics Ratings at 25 C ambient temperature unless otherwise specified. Single phase, half wave, 60Hz, resistive or inductive load. Characteristic Maximum Recurrent Peak Reverse Voltage Maximum RMS Voltage Maximum DC Blocking voltage Maximum Average Forward Rectified Current (9.5mm) Lead Length @ TA=75C Peak Forward Surge Current 8.3 ms single half sine-wave superimposed on rated load (JEDEC method) Maximum Instantaneous Forward Voltage at 3.0A DC Maximum DC Reverse Current Maximum Reverse Recovery Time (Note 1) Typical Junction Capacitance (Note 2) Operating and Storage Temperature Range Symbol VRRM VRMS VDC I(AV) IFSM VF IR Trr CJ TJ, TSTG 150 70 -65 to +175 FR 301 50 35 50 FR 302 100 70 100 FR 303 200 140 200 FR 304 400 280 400 3.0 150 1.3 10 250 50 500 FR 305 600 420 600 FR 306 800 560 800 FR 307 1000 700 1000 Unit V V V A A V A ns pF C Notes: 1. Reverse Recovery Test Conditions: IF =0.5 A, IR =1.0 A, IRR =0.25 A 2. Measured at 1 MHz and applied reverse voltage of 4.0 volts. DS26003 Rev.
